What We Look For In an ACT Math Tutor
We are seeking highly skilled and dedicated tutors who possess the following qualities:
- Advanced Math Content Mastery:
- Deep knowledge across all ACT Math topics including pre-algebra (fractions, decimals, percentages), elementary algebra, intermediate algebra, coordinate geometry, plane geometry, and trigonometry (SOH-CAH-TOA, unit circle, identities).
- Ability to comprehensively explain 60 questions across all topics within a 60-minute time limit.
- Proficiency in calculator strategies and efficient formula recall for rapid problem-solving.
- Strategic Problem-Solving & Speed:
- Skilled at teaching rapid solution identification, backsolving techniques, and strategic skipping of difficult questions.
- Adept at guiding students through multi-step word problems, geometry proofs, graphing functions, and trigonometric applications.
- Emphasis on calculator efficiency, estimation skills, and recognizing high-frequency question types to maximize student speed and accuracy.
- Test Strategy & Adaptive Instruction:
- Familiarity with the ACT Math progression (easier early questions, harder later questions) and common pitfalls like misreading problems and calculation errors.
- Ability to adapt instruction through timed drills, formula sheet creation, and targeted practice on weak areas (e.g., geometry, trigonometry).
- Requires a minimum ACT Math score of 31 and proven methods for score improvement.
